    @AviownCorp Its not so hard. You build each part separately: instrument panel, chair, stick, throtle, pedals. Then each part gets attached to a small "anchor" block that gets nudged away (but still attached). You then grab it by the anchor block, attach that to the plane and carefully nudge the peices into place. Finetuner can do most of the work, but some people position it all by hand. Then nudge the anchor blocks inside the fuselage where no one can see them.
